                For the function: f(x)= 2+x-x^2/ (x-1)^2 ; f'(x)= x-5/(x-1)^3 ; f''(x)=2x-14/(x-1)^4
a)find vertical and horizontal asymptotes. Examine vertical asymptote on either side of discontinuity.
b)find any local extrema
c)find points of inflection

    vertical asymptotes where (x-1) = 0 : x=1
horizontal asymptote at y = -x^2/x^2 = -1
extrema where f'=0 : at x=5
inflection where f"=0 : at x=7
